Why urethane dominates production casting+
Urethane casting resins reproduce fine detail, cure fast enough to run several cycles a day from one silicone mould, and give a hard, paintable, machinable part. Compared with epoxy they demould far sooner; compared with polyester they smell less and shrink less. That combination is why bridge tooling and short-run production casting almost always start with urethane.
Pot life is the design constraint+
Many casting urethanes have very short working times, so mould filling, mixing method and batch size must be planned around the pot life of the grade rather than the other way round. Thin sections, complex mould geometry, or several moulds per batch may require a slower grade even if a faster one is available. Selecting pot life first prevents most casting failures.
Moisture, bubbles and surface defects+
Isocyanates react with water, so damp moulds, humid air, wet fillers and open containers cause foaming and pinholes. Standard practice is sealed containers, dry fillers and pigments, moulds at working temperature, careful mixing to avoid whipping in air, and pressure or vacuum casting where surface quality is critical.
Filling, colouring and post-processing+
Mineral fillers can be added for weight, stiffness, cost or thermal behaviour, and pigment pastes formulated for urethane give consistent colour. Fillers change viscosity, exotherm and pot life, so any filled formulation is treated as a new specification with its own trial. Cast parts are typically demoulded, allowed to reach full properties, then trimmed, machined or painted.

Frequently asked questions
How many parts can be cast per silicone mould?+
Mould life depends on the resin, part geometry, release practice and cycle rate. Production shops establish it by trial and then treat mould replacement as a running cost.
Why are there bubbles in my castings?+
Common causes are entrained air from mixing, moisture in the mould or filler, and trapped air in the mould geometry. Pressure casting is the usual production answer for bubble-free parts.
Can fillers and pigments be added?+
Yes, using dry fillers and urethane-compatible pigment pastes. Any addition changes viscosity, pot life and exotherm, so trial the exact formulation before production.
How is pot life selected?+
Start from the mould fill: part size, mould complexity, number of moulds per batch and mixing method. Choose the grade whose working time comfortably covers that sequence.
Is urethane resin UV stable?+
Unmodified urethanes commonly yellow with UV exposure. Where colour stability matters, state it in the enquiry so a grade formulated for the requirement is quoted.
